Sdnfuture0404Mininet的可视化应用v1_第1页
Sdnfuture0404Mininet的可视化应用v1_第2页
Sdnfuture0404Mininet的可视化应用v1_第3页
Sdnfuture0404Mininet的可视化应用v1_第4页
Sdnfuture0404Mininet的可视化应用v1_第5页
已阅读5页,还剩10页未读 继续免费阅读

付费下载

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

Mininet的可视化应用目录Mininet的可视化应用1实验演示Mininet可视化2Miniedit可视化,直接在界面上编辑任意拓扑,生成python自定义拓扑脚本,简单方便。Mininet2.2.0+内置miniedit。在mininet/examples下提供miniedit.py脚本,执行脚本后显示可视化界面,可自定义拓扑及配置属性。Miniedit启动自定义创建拓扑,设置设备信息运行拓扑并生成拓扑脚本Miniedit三步走启动miniedit3进入mininet/examples目录下,执行miniedit.py文件:#sudo./miniedit.py注意:执行miniedit.py,需要在桌面版系统下,或支持X11的情况下使用。Linux桌面版系统下可直接执行;远程使用Mininet虚拟机,需使用Xmanager或Xming。Miniedit可视化4执行miniedit.py启动Mininet可视化界面后,界面显示如下:Miniedit拓扑建立5选择左侧的网络组件,在空白区域单击鼠标左键即可添加网络组件,可选择的组件主要有主机、OpenFlow交换机、传统交换机,传统路由器、链路、控制器。Miniedit属性配置6设备及链路上可进行鼠标右击长按,选择Properties即可对其进行配置。Miniedit属性配置(续)7设备属性配置OK后,将会在miniedit.py执行的后台产生日志,告知所添加的设备属性。主机属性需配置IP地址:链路属性:Miniedit全局配置8Miniedit左上角“Edit”中可以剪切删除设备,及对整个网络进行全局配置。Miniedit全局配置Miniedit运行9点击左下角“run”,即可运行设置好的网络拓扑,同时在后台可以看到相应的配置信息。运行后对交换机、主机进行右击长按,可查看交换机的bridge信息及打开Host的终端。使用exit退出主机终端Miniedit保存脚本10miniedit设置好拓扑后,可通过选择File-ExportLevel2Script,将其保存为python脚本,默认在mininet/examples目录下,通过chmod给此脚本权限后,直接运行即可重现拓扑。Miniedit脚本执行11通过后台查看保存的sdnlab.py脚本文件,并给脚本赋予权限:#chmod–R777sdnlab.py执行sdnlab.py脚本:#./sdnlab.py目录Mininet的可视化应用12实验演示Mininet的可视化应用实验13设备名称软件环境硬件环境主机Ubuntu14.04桌面版

Mininet2.2.0CPU:1核内存:2G磁盘:20G控制器Ubuntu14.04桌面版

OpenDaylightLithiumCPU:2核内存:4G磁盘:20G任务目的熟悉Mininet可视化界面。掌握自定义拓扑及拓扑设备设置的方法,实现自定义脚本。任务内容在可视化界面上自定义创建拓扑,并设置设备信息。通过可视化界面生成拓扑

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

最新文档

评论

0/150

提交评论